General notes
The Pudsey family were the owners of the Bolton-by-Bowland demesne and lived in Bolton Hall for many generations. Many are buried in the local church. One of their number, Sir Ralph Pudsey, is reputed to have leapt from this promontory into the river Ribble in the 15th Century.
